They move on treads and use giant lances attached to their frontal armor plates to ram and [[attack]]. Autolances do not [[flinch]] from any attack and are quite resistant to attacks with their helmets on, making them somewhat threatening, especially when coupled with other enemies. An Autolance's weak spot is inside its armored-helmet head in the form of an emergency light. This light is exposed once its armor receives enough damage. | ||
Autolances have three different types of attacks - the first is a long-range move where it launches a giant lance at the player which can be reflected. The second is a close-ranged weak thrust, and a skyward swipe that follows up quickly. The first strike inflicts weak knockback, while the latter inflicts mainly vertical knockback. ==Name origin== | ==Name origin== | ||
The enemy's name is a combination of the prefix ''{{iw|wiktionary|auto-}}'' (possibly ''automotive''), being a machine capable of moving by itself, and ''{{iw|wikipedia|lance}}'', the weapon it uses to attack. Its appearance seems to be based on the helmet of a medieval knight. The ''-lance'' part of its name could also come from ''ambulance'', since under the helmet is a siren. Once its helmet is knocked off, an Autolance gains speed, the same way an ambulance speeds during an emergency. | |||
